Abstract
The invention discloses a composite sweetener. The compositions by weight percentage of the composite sweetener comprise 2 to 5 percent of aspartame and 95 to 98 percent of fillers. A plurality of fillers such as fructose, lactose, glucose, maltodextrin and so on can be selected in order to obtain different flavors, and a small amount of anticaking agents can be added to prevent the product from being caked so as to be convenient for storage. Because the effective compositions comprise the aspartame, the amount of the sweetener is reduced, the calorie intake index, the blood sugar index and the decayed tooth index are effectively reduced. The sweetener adopts a special formula and quickly tastes sweet after eaten; the mouth is filled with a soft and smooth feel; when the sweetener is added into drink for drinking, people can not feel poor after-taste and the time of the sweet taste staying in the mouth is long; and the sweetener has better mouthfeel compared with similar products.

Background technology
Sucrose is widely used as general diet product sweetener always, especially uses in a large number in drinks such as coffee, milk, fruit juice.But, being subjected to the influence of healthy purpose or purpose low in calories in recent years, the tendency of appearance is that the use amount that reduces sucrose is used high-intensity sweeteners to avoid obesity, diabetes, decayed tooth etc. or alternative granulated sugar.At present, the high-intensity sweeteners of selling on the market mainly contains Aspartame, acesulfame potassium (hereinafter referred to as Ace-K), Sucralose, stevioside etc., and its sugariness is the hundred times of sucrose by weight, is widely used in fields such as food, beverage.
Because the difference of consumer individual taste, sugariness in the Food ﹠ Drink liked the degree difference.In some cases, the consumer requires a kind of goods for consumption is increased sweet in unique individualized level, and is not limited in the selection that the Foods or drinks producer is provided.Therefore, occurred, added to make things convenient for the consumer to comply with individual taste with high sweetener and the composite various sucrose substitutes that form of filler.The inner wrapping compound sweetener of Chu Xianing mainly contains Aspartame and two kinds of forms of Sucralose in the market, but all not satisfactory mouthfeel that does not reach sucrose of its proportioning.
Always there is the sweet taste defective in single high-intensity sweeteners, such as Aspartame, with regard to its sweet taste quality, and compares as the sucrose of sweet taste quality metewand, and is preceding lightly seasoned and the back is highly seasoned, and has tangible bitter taste.The sugariness of Ace-K and Aspartame is suitable, is about 200 times of sucrose, but compares with the latter that its preceding flavor, bitter taste, astringent taste and excitant are strong, and sweet taste is not good more.Sucralose is to be derived through chlorination by sucrose, its sugariness is 600~650 times of sucrose, and stable in properties does not have any peculiar smell, and its sweet taste characteristic is better than Aspartame and Ace-K, yet compare with sucrose and to still have a certain distance, after composite, can reach better effect with other sweeteners.In addition, compare Aspartame and Ace-K, Sucralose production difficulty is big, and price is higher, is difficult to worldwide promote.
Summary of the invention
At the problem that prior art exists, the object of the present invention is to provide a kind of taste more near the compound sweetener prescription of sucrose, and reach and reduce calorie intake, glycemic index and carious tooth index, reduce effects such as production cost.
For achieving the above object, a kind of compound sweetener of the present invention, its composition contains by weight percentage: Aspartame 2-5%, filler 95-98%.
Further, described filler is a lactose, fructose, glucose, one or more in the maltodextrin.
Further, also comprise anticaking agent in the described compound sweetener, contain 0.2-2% by weight percentage.
Further, described anticaking agent is a kind of in potassium ferrocyanide, sodium silicoaluminate, tricalcium phosphate, silica and the microcrystalline cellulose.
Further, described filler is fructose and lactose, and when described anticaking agent was silica, the composition of compound sweetener contained Aspartame 2-5%, lactose 50-90%, fructose 5-43% and silica 0.2-2% by weight percentage.
Further, described filler is fructose and lactose, and described anticaking agent is a silica, and the composition of compound sweetener contains Aspartame 3-4.5%, lactose 64.5-85.5%, fructose 10-30% and silica 0.2-1% by weight percentage.
Further, the composition best proportion of described compound sweetener by weight percentage count Aspartame 3.6%, lactose 75.9%, fructose 20% and silica 0.5%.
Further, described filler is glucose and maltodextrin, and the composition of compound sweetener contains Aspartame 2-5%, glucose 50-81.5% and maltodextrin 13.5-48% by weight percentage.
Further, described filler is glucose and maltodextrin, and the composition of compound sweetener contains Aspartame 3-4.5%, glucose 65-81.5% and maltodextrin 14-32% by weight percentage.
Further, the composition best proportion of described compound sweetener by weight percentage count Aspartame 3.8%, glucose 81.2% and maltodextrin 15%.
The preparation method of above-mentioned compound sweetener is specially: with the compound sweetener mixture directly be mixed into powder-product or by do, wet method and existing method of granulating make grain products or make finished product by spray drying process.
Its effective ingredient of compound sweetener of the present invention is Aspartame and various filler, use lactose and fructose do filler make sweetener contain the combination of frankincense and fruital flavor glucose and maltodextrin then taste is light slightly, refrigerant sensation is arranged, place the problem that occurs caking too for a long time in order to prevent product, also added a small amount of anticaking agent among the present invention, can not impact when preventing the product caking the product taste.Compound sweetener of the present invention can be taked directly effective ingredient to be mixed into powder-product, by do, wet method and existing method of granulating are made grain products or spray drying process is made several different methods such as finished product and made.Compound sweetener of the present invention has comprised Aspartame, because the sugariness of Aspartame is about 200 times of sucrose, and added different fillers therein, use more a spot of sweetener just can reach the sugariness that use sucrose is cooked sweetener, so the consumption of sweetener will reduce greatly, effectively reduce calorie intake, blood sugar and carious tooth index, sweetener of the present invention adopts special formula, this sweetener inlet can be felt sweet taste rapidly, and kind of a soft and smooth sensation is arranged, and is full of the oral cavity, add in the drink and drink, do not have bad aftertaste, and sweet taste to be trapped in time in oral cavity long, better mouthfeel is arranged compared with similar products.
